8.4.1 Face milling (CYCLE61)
Function
You can face mill any workpiece with the "Face milling" cycle.
A rectangular surface is always machined. The rectangle is obtained from corner points 1
and 2 - which for a ShopTurn program - are pre-assigned with the values of the blank part
dimensions from the program header.
Workpieces with and without limits can be face-milled.

Approach/retraction
1. For vertical machining, the starting point is always at the top or bottom. For horizontal
machining, it is at the left or right.
The starting point is marked in the help display.
2. Machining is performed from the outside to the inside.
